What Characteristics Should a Mattress Have to Relieve Pelvic Pain?
When looking for the best mattress for pelvic pain relief, several key characteristics should be considered.
- Supportive Surface: A mattress should provide adequate support to maintain proper spinal alignment, which can alleviate pressure on the pelvis and lower back. A medium-firm mattress is often recommended, as it balances support and comfort, preventing the hips from sinking too deeply.
- Pressure Relief: Materials that offer pressure relief, such as memory foam or latex, can help distribute body weight evenly. This minimizes discomfort in sensitive areas, including the pelvis, by reducing the stress on joints and muscles during sleep.
- Durability: A high-quality mattress should be durable enough to maintain its supportive characteristics over time. Look for mattresses with warranties and high-density materials, ensuring they won’t sag or lose their shape, which could lead to discomfort.
- Motion Isolation: Good motion isolation is essential for couples, as it prevents disturbances from a partner’s movements. This feature allows for uninterrupted sleep, which is crucial for recovery from pelvic pain.
- Temperature Regulation: A mattress that helps regulate temperature can enhance sleep quality by preventing overheating. Look for materials that promote airflow, such as gel-infused foam or breathable covers, to ensure a comfortable sleeping environment.
- Adjustability: An adjustable mattress or bed can provide personalized comfort, allowing users to change the firmness and position to find their ideal sleeping posture. This can be particularly beneficial for those dealing with pelvic pain, as it enables the adjustment of pressure points.

Why Is Support Important for Reducing Pelvic Pain?
Support is crucial for reducing pelvic pain because it helps maintain proper spinal alignment and alleviates pressure on sensitive areas, particularly the pelvic region. A mattress that provides adequate support distributes body weight evenly, preventing excessive sinking or misalignment that can exacerbate pain.
According to a study published in the Journal of Orthopaedic & Sports Physical Therapy, individuals with chronic pelvic pain reported significant improvement after using a supportive mattress designed to enhance spinal alignment (Higgins et al., 2021). The right level of firmness can also reduce muscle tension and promote better sleep quality, which is vital for recovery from pain conditions.
The underlying mechanism involves the relationship between sleep posture and musculoskeletal health. A mattress that offers proper support encourages a neutral spine position, which minimizes strain on the ligaments and muscles surrounding the pelvis. When the spine is aligned, it reduces the likelihood of muscle spasms and tension that can lead to or worsen pelvic pain. Additionally, adequate support can help maintain circulation, which is essential for healing and reducing inflammation in painful areas.
What Mattress Types Are Most Recommended for Pelvic Pain?
The best mattress types for pelvic pain provide adequate support and comfort to alleviate pressure points and promote proper spinal alignment.
- Memory Foam: Memory foam mattresses are highly recommended for pelvic pain as they contour to the body, providing customized support and pressure relief. The material absorbs movement, which is beneficial if you share a bed, minimizing disturbances during the night.
- Latex: Latex mattresses offer a balance of support and comfort, with a responsive surface that maintains its shape while offering pressure relief. They tend to be cooler than memory foam and are often more durable, making them a good long-term investment for those with pelvic discomfort.
- Hybrid: Hybrid mattresses combine the support of innerspring coils with the comfort of foam or latex layers. This type allows for enhanced breathability and support, which can be beneficial for pelvic pain sufferers who need pressure relief without sacrificing firmness.
- Adjustable Air Beds: Adjustable air beds allow users to customize the firmness level, which can help alleviate pelvic pain by providing a tailored sleeping surface. Being able to adjust the firmness can be particularly useful for individuals with varying levels of pain or discomfort, accommodating changes over time.
- Firm Mattresses: A firm mattress can be beneficial for pelvic pain if it provides adequate support to maintain spinal alignment. However, it’s essential that it doesn’t create pressure points; therefore, a well-designed firm mattress with a comfort layer is ideal.

What Firmness Level Is Best for Individuals with Pelvic Pain?
The best firmness level for individuals with pelvic pain varies based on personal preference, body type, and sleeping position.
- Soft Mattress: A soft mattress is often recommended for individuals who experience pelvic pain, particularly for side sleepers. It allows for better contouring to the body’s curves, which helps alleviate pressure on the hips and lower back, providing a more comfortable sleeping surface.
- Medium-Firm Mattress: A medium-firm mattress strikes a balance between support and comfort, making it a popular choice for those with pelvic pain. It provides adequate support for the spine while also allowing some give to relieve pressure points, making it suitable for back and side sleepers alike.
- Firm Mattress: A firm mattress may be beneficial for stomach sleepers or individuals who prefer a more supportive surface. While it helps maintain spinal alignment, it may not be ideal for everyone, as it can create pressure points on the hips and pelvis if too rigid.
- Adjustable Mattress: An adjustable mattress allows users to customize the firmness level to their specific needs, which can be particularly helpful for individuals with pelvic pain. By allowing adjustments in firmness, it can cater to different sleeping positions and preferences, providing tailored support.
Should Any Specific Firmnesses Be Avoided?
No, specific firmnesses should not be universally avoided when selecting a mattress for pelvic pain, as individual preferences and body types vary significantly.
When it comes to pelvic pain, the best mattress firmness is often subjective. Some people may find relief on a softer mattress that allows for deeper contouring, which can alleviate pressure points, while others might prefer a firmer mattress that provides better support and alignment of the spine. The key is to find a balance that suits your personal comfort and sleeping position, as side sleepers often benefit from a softer surface, whereas back or stomach sleepers might require more support.
Additionally, factors such as weight distribution, body shape, and any underlying medical conditions play a crucial role in determining the optimal mattress firmness. It is advisable to test different firmness levels and materials, such as memory foam, latex, or hybrid options, to identify which type provides the most comfort and support for your specific pelvic pain issues. Personal experiences vary widely, so what works for one person might not work for another.
